Abstract

The utility model provides a full-automatic flotation reagent quantitative adding system which comprises a liquid level detector, a pressure release valve, a metering pump, a safety circuit controlled by an electromagnetic valve, an electromagnetic flowmeter, a dustproof negative-pressure discharge funnel and a programmable controller used for processing and controlling feedback signals. The full-automatic flotation reagent quantitative adding system has the advantages of being capable of accurately and stably controlling the amount of reagents, preventing reagent shortage and carrying out partition and return for unpredictable emergency in downstream. According to the full-automatic flotation reagent quantitative adding system, the metering pump capable of accurately adjusting the output amount and the electromagnet flowmeter capable of accurately measuring the flow are introduced into the floatation reagent adding system. Thus, the problem of failure, caused by negative pressure in pipelines, of the metering pump can be effectively solved. Furthermore, automatic adding of reagents in a reagent barrel, liquid level detection and alarm are achieved. The full-automatic flotation reagent quantitative adding system is further provided with the safety circuit. All components of the system are stable in operation. Meanwhile, automatic control can reduce labor intensity of operators to the maximum degree.

Technical field
The application relates to flotation dosing field, relates in particular to full-automatic coal slime floating agent and quantitatively adds field.
Background technology
Flotation, the abbreviation of floating ore dressing, is according to the difference of mineral grain Surface Physical Chemistry character, carries out the method for sorting by the difference of mineral floatability.
In floating separation process, for effectively selecting point valuable mineral and a gangue mineral, or separate various valuable mineral, often need to add some medicament, to change the physicochemical properties of mineral surfaces and the character of medium,
These medicaments are referred to as floating agent.
Manually make up a prescription and be difficult to accurate control, and waste time and energy, while particularly needing several medicament, need to expend a lot of manpowers simultaneously, operation element amount is very large.And the restrictions such as being subject to workman's sense of responsibility, technical experience, qualification of manually making up a prescription, the one, cannot make up a prescription accurately, the 2nd, cannot make up a prescription on time, lack the disconnected medicine of medicine and happen occasionally, larger to Influence of production.
Utility model content
One of the purpose of this utility model is the quantitative add-on system of full-automatic coal slime floating agent that can solve at least one aspect in above-mentioned aspect.
According to an aspect of the present utility model, provide a kind of full-automatic coal slime floating agent quantitative add-on system, the quantitative add-on system of described full-automatic coal slime floating agent comprises:
Measuring pump, described measuring pump is used to whole medicament system to add pan feeding;
Feeding pipe, gos deep into medicament barrel bottom from medicament barrel upper end, and described feeding pipe lower end is provided with filter, for filter liquide medicament coarse granule impurity;
Liquid level detector, is located at medicament barrel top, and for liquid level on the inner medicament of Real-Time Monitoring medicament barrel, feedback liquid level data, and make system at the too high or too low alarm of liquid level, close simultaneously or open medicament device for supplying, realize medicament automatic makeup to.
Dustproof negative pressure discharge hopper, is located at system medicament exit, and atmospheric pressure UNICOM, for unload the negative pressure causing when liquid preparation flows automatically downwards in pipeline, avoids the compound pump causing due to this negative pressure to lose efficacy or metering misalignment.
Preferably, the quantitative add-on system of described full-automatic coal slime floating agent also comprises relief valve, and described relief valve is located at medicament barrel top, with atmosphere UNICOM, be used for preventing due to reagent consumption or add and cause medicament barrel internal pressure to change, avoiding the pan feeding measuring pump operation irregularity causing thus.
Preferably, the quantitative add-on system of described full-automatic coal slime floating agent also comprises electromagnetic flowmeter, after described electromagnetic flowmeter is connected in pan feeding measuring pump, be supplied to total pharmaceutical quantities of flotation size mixing equipment for accurately measuring whole system, and return data is to Programmable Logic Controller.
Preferably, the quantitative add-on system of described full-automatic coal slime floating agent also comprises safety return circuit, and described safety return circuit is connected between pan feeding measuring pump and electromagnetic flowmeter, and its lower end is back in medicament barrel.
Preferably, between described electromagnetic flowmeter and dustproof negative pressure discharge hopper He in safety return circuit, be provided with electromagnetic valve, be respectively medicament flow rate fine-tuning valve and safety return-flow valve.
Preferably, described pan feeding measuring pump, electromagnetic flowmeter, liquid level detector, safety return-flow valve and flow rate fine-tuning valve are connected with Programmable Logic Controller by wired or wireless mode, and described Programmable Logic Controller is accepted each parts return data and to the instruction of corresponding actions parts sending action.
Automatic medicament feeding system of the present utility model has the following advantages, pharmaceutical quantities precise control, system unit is stable, can effectively prevent that negative pressure self-priming from causing measuring pump to lose efficacy, realizing automatically adding of medicament barrel medicament detects with liquid level and reports to the police, be provided with safety return circuit, in section's automation control simultaneously, large degree, reduced operating personnel's labour intensity.

As shown in Figure 1, generally include the measuring pump 1 for pan feeding according to the quantitative add-on system of full-automatic floating agent of the utility model embodiment; Electromagnetic flowmeter 2; Relief valve 3 and liquid level detector 4, be arranged on medicament barrel top; Safety return circuit, the pipeline UNICOM between its one end and measuring pump 1 and electromagnetic flowmeter 2, the other end and medicament barrel UNICOM; On safety return circuit, be provided with electromagnetic valve 5; Flow rate fine-tuning electromagnetic valve 6, before being arranged at electromagnetic flowmeter medicament outlet afterwards; Be provided with dustproof negative pressure discharge hopper 7 in medicament exit.
As shown in Figure 2, described dustproof negative pressure discharge hopper 7 is divided into upper and lower two parts, the spill cylinder 71 that top is lower ending opening, and bottom is conical hopper 72, top cylinder diameter is greater than the maximum gauge of lower taper funnel; Lower part is upwards deep in spill cylinder, but does not contact, rely on rigidity and the outside firmware of pipeline separately to keep its relative position.
In the present embodiment, described pan feeding measuring pump, electromagnetic flowmeter, liquid level detector, safety return-flow valve and flow rate fine-tuning valve are connected with Programmable Logic Controller by wired or wireless mode, and described Programmable Logic Controller is accepted each parts return data and to the instruction of corresponding actions parts sending action.
Operation principle and the course of work of the quantitative add-on system of described full-automatic floating agent are as follows:
Start the quantitative add-on system of full-automatic floating agent, first liquid level detector is measured the pharmaceutical quantities in medicament barrel, if pharmaceutical quantities does not reach requirement, sends warning signal, and requires to add medicament; If pharmaceutical quantities meets the requirements, open pan feeding measuring pump, medicament, through after electromagnetic flowmeter survey flow, enters flotation size mixing equipment in gravity flow mode after dustproof negative pressure discharge hopper.
Need to adjust dosing time, only need input relative order to Programmable Logic Controller, elder generation is opened fine setting electromagnetic valve completely by Programmable Logic Controller, then adjust pan feeding measuring pump parameter, electromagnetic flowmeter value of feedback is equaled or be slightly larger than desired value, if value of feedback equals desired value, directly output; If value of feedback is slightly larger than desired value, fine setting electromagnetic valve aperture is regulated, until value of feedback equals desired value.
The utility model can more accurately be adjusted the measuring pump of output quantity, the electromagnetic flowmeter of Accurate Measurement flow is introduced floating agent add-on system, and design primarily dustproof negative pressure discharge hopper, before effectively having solved, some plant area's medicament add-on systems are due to the existence of pipe negative pressure, the problem that the measuring pump causing lost efficacy, realize automatically adding of medicament barrel medicament and detect with liquid level and report to the police, and be provided with safety return circuit.The precise control of whole system pharmaceutical quantities, system unit is stable, has reduced operating personnel's labour intensity in the control of automation simultaneously, large degree.
